Godiva Whisper

Godiva Whisper is a blended cocktail with chocolate cream liqueur, cognac, and vanilla ice cream. A decadent after-dinner drink served in a snifter.

Three ingredients, one blender, and about 30 seconds between you and the richest after-dinner cocktail you’ve ever had. Chocolate cream liqueur (Godiva is the classic choice), a pour of cognac, and three scoops of vanilla ice cream get blended smooth and served in a snifter.

The cognac is what keeps this from tasting like a plain chocolate milkshake. Its brandy warmth cuts through the sweetness of the liqueur and ice cream, adding depth and a slow burn on the finish. Without it, you’d have dessert. With it, you’ve got a proper drink.

Serve it immediately after blending. The ice cream melts fast once it hits the glass, and you want that thick, creamy consistency, not a thin, separated puddle.

Pro Tips

  • Use good vanilla ice cream. Premium brands with higher fat content blend thicker and taste richer.
  • Chill the glass in the freezer for a few minutes before pouring. A cold snifter keeps the drink thick longer.
  • If it’s too thick to sip, add a splash more cognac. If too thin, add another half scoop of ice cream.

Variations

  • Coffee Godiva Whisper: Use coffee ice cream instead of vanilla for a mocha twist that’s even more complex.
  • Chocolate Godiva Whisper: Swap the vanilla ice cream for chocolate for a triple-chocolate indulgence that leans even darker.

Ingredients

¾ 21.7
OUNCE ML/G LIQUEUR
chocolate cream, eg. godiva
½ 14.5
OUNCE ML/G COGNAC
3 3
SCOOPS SCOOPS VANILLA ICE CREAM *

Directions

Combine ingredients in a blender until smooth.

Serve in a snifter or cocktail glass.

Also delicious with coffee or chocolate ice cream.
